Organic Elements

Incorporating organic elements into your spiritual space can greatly improve its peaceful atmosphere and connect you more intimately with nature. Begin by utilizing natural materials like wood, stone, or bamboo for your furnishings or decorations. These materials introduce an earthy vibe, helping to ground your space. Integrating indoor plants can significantly enhance the tranquility of your environment. Opt for easy-care varieties like snake plants or peace lilies that purify the air and require minimal maintenance. You might even consider establishing a small herb garden for added fragrance and liveliness. Surrounding yourself with these natural elements not only beautifies your room but also cultivates a sense of serenity, enriching your spiritual practice and connecting you to the natural world.
Aromatherapy Tools

Aromatherapy can convert your spiritual room into a sanctuary of tranquility and ease. By integrating essential oils, you create a welcoming environment that amplifies your meditation and mindfulness activities. Select scents like lavender for relaxation and eucalyptus for clarity. Blending essential oils can yield delightful fragrance combinations; consider citrus and mint for an uplifting experience or sandalwood and frankincense for a grounding atmosphere. Utilize a diffuser to spread the scents throughout your area, ensuring a consistent aroma that promotes relaxation. You can also add a few drops to your bath or apply them topically mixed with a carrier oil for extra benefits. Embrace the power of aromatherapy and let these fragrances elevate your spiritual room into a sanctuary of tranquility.

Motivational Books and Resources

While you may already possess a solid collection of tools and methods for your spiritual practice, it is crucial to include motivational books and resources that can broaden your understanding and invigorate your journey. Here are some bookSuggestions to foster your spiritual development:
- “The Power of Now” by Eckhart Tolle – A resource that highlights the importance of residing in the present.
- “The Four Agreements” by Don Miguel Ruiz – Provides a guideline for behavior grounded in age-old Toltec wisdom.
- “Awaken the Giant Within” by Tony Robbins – Motivates you to seize command of your life and feelings.
- “The Art of Happiness” by Dalai Lama – Offers wisdom on attaining genuine happiness through compassion.
These materials can enrich your connection to your practice and provide new viewpoints.
